Optimal Power Allocation for Space-time Coded OFDM UWB Systems
In the last years, a lot of attention has been devoted to ultra wideband (UWB) systems. The multi-antenna and/or multi-carrier UWB transceiver designs have been well-documented.Compared with great progress at physical layer, the corresponding medium access control (MAC) layer protocol designs are naturally placed on the schedules. In this paper, we focus on the optimal power allocation scheme, which is an integral part of the MAC layer protocol design, for UWB orthogonal frequency-division multiplexing (OFDM) transmissions with space-time code (STC). To maximize the capacity, two kinds of power allocation schemes were presented based on perfect CSI or partial CSI respectively in frequency-selective UWB channels. And our scheme can be easily extended to multi-band system. The analysis and numerical results show good performance.
